学习记录----linux命令学习
2014-07-25 10:19
211 查看
1.在linux下查找文件或者按内容查找文件
grep -r "*****" ./目录
2.查找文件的安装路径
whereis ****
3.
4.
grep -r -E "jin" filename | grep "qi" 说明:这里加上-r -E选项,可以使用证则表达式,优先筛选后面的内容,可能是在最后一行输出。
5.
解释:-r:循环查找 -E:使用正则表达式
6.grep 中不输出查找结果,只输出是否匹配
grep -q string ./ -q表示安静查找,匹配:返回0 不匹配:返回1 错误:返回2
7.c语言中使用shell命令 参考:http://www.cnblogs.com/niocai/archive/2011/07/20/2111896.html
8.将grep 的结果导入文件保存
8.
使用wc命令 具体通过wc --help 可以查看。
如:wc -l filename 就是查看文件里有多少行
wc -w filename 看文件里有多少个word。
wc -L filename 文件里最长的那一行是多少个字。
grep -r "*****" ./目录
2.查找文件的安装路径
whereis ****
3.
在linux下输入错误的命令 退不出来要怎么办?
按ctrl+c,或者ctrl+],或者ctrl+d,对于不同的情况不同命令来结束指令
4.
linux用grep查找包含两个关键字的命令
grep "jin" filename | grep "qi"grep -r -E "jin" filename | grep "qi" 说明:这里加上-r -E选项,可以使用证则表达式,优先筛选后面的内容,可能是在最后一行输出。
5.
linux用grep查找包含多条命令的操作
grep -r -E "string|namespace|helloword" ./解释:-r:循环查找 -E:使用正则表达式
6.grep 中不输出查找结果,只输出是否匹配
grep -q string ./ -q表示安静查找,匹配:返回0 不匹配:返回1 错误:返回2
7.c语言中使用shell命令 参考:http://www.cnblogs.com/niocai/archive/2011/07/20/2111896.html
#include<stdlib.h> main() { system(“ls -al /etc/passwd /etc/shadow”); }
8.将grep 的结果导入文件保存
grep $aabbcc file1 >file2 1.根据变量查找,将匹配结果放入文件file2 2.>每次查找的结果覆盖原来的结果 >>每次查找的结果,在原来的结果结尾写入
8.
linux查看文件有多少行
wc命令的功能为统计指定文件中的字节数、字数、行数, 并将统计结果显示输出。使用wc命令 具体通过wc --help 可以查看。
如:wc -l filename 就是查看文件里有多少行
wc -w filename 看文件里有多少个word。
wc -L filename 文件里最长的那一行是多少个字。
相关文章推荐
- linux命令学习记录
- Linux学习记录--命令与文件的查询
- Linux学习记录(3)认识终端以及一些基本的操作命令
- linux命令学习使用记录
- linux个人学习笔记---ubuntu14.10删除播放器历史记录命令
- Linux环境命令学习记录
- Linux命令学习记录
- Linux学习记录(4)系统常用命令学习
- Linux常用操作命令学习使用实时记录
- Linux学习之路:命令别名、历史记录和命令查找执行顺序
- Linux基础知识学习记录:su与sudo命令的比较,ubuntu下的inittab文件
- Linux学习记录--管道命令
- Linux学习记录--管道命令
- Linux学习记录-2015-08-20--常用命令1
- Linux命令学习记录(一直更新)
- linux命令学习记录
- Linux学习记录--vim与vi常用命令
- Linux学习记录--命名别名与历史命令
- Linux命令学习记录
- Linux学习记录(9)Linux基本网络命令